SPOTLIGHT ON A MAJOR PROJECT:

Bremore Ireland Port (€300 million , 2002-2013)

In 2002, the Drogheda Port Company began the development on a deepwater port, logistics centre and business park away from the existing congested hub of Dublin city.

A full international design team was appointed in 2006 to complete the operational port design and planning application. Terminal operator Hutchison Westports Limited joined the team to develop and operate the Terminal Master Plan.

In January 2008 the Drogheda Port Company and Castle Market Holdings Ltd. entered a joint venture partnership called Bremore Ireland Port Ltd. to further develop the project.

The project, to be divided in three phases, was due to submit a full planning application in 2009 .

Phase 1 will potentially cater to up to 10 million tonnes of freight including 350,000 TEU Lo-Lo units, 409,000 Ro-Ro units and 1 million tonnes of general and bulk cargoes .

In total the Bremore Ireland Port could cater to up to 50 million tonnes of annual freight traffic .
